About Breakfast burger

The Breakfast Burger combines morning classics with the indulgence of a juicy burger, creating a hearty spin on the best of both worlds. This flavorful creation typically features a beef patty layered with a fried egg, crispy bacon, melted cheddar cheese, and a dollop of creamy aioli, all nestled between a buttery brioche bun. Some variations may include avocado slices or sautéed spinach for added freshness and nutrients. Originating from American diner cuisine, the Breakfast Burger showcases the richness and comfort of a classic morning meal in a compact form. While high in protein from the meat and eggs, it can be calorie-dense, with saturated fats from the bacon, cheese, and bun. Enjoyed in moderation or with healthier tweaks—like swapping bacon for turkey bacon or using a whole-grain bun—it can be a satisfying start that fuels both appetite and energy.
